I got tired of the old dirty egress window and decided to upgrade. I used an old step ladder - whitewashed it, and cut it in half. Found some cheap silver pails and greenery at Walmart. Also found a cool string of solar lights there. The round circle planter I found at Marshall's. Used some cheap hooks and hung it all up! Oh, the best part - Cocoa Husk Mulch fro Menards. Open the window and it smells like chocolate!
